u  学习经历

§  2003年于西北工业大学获学士学位

§  2008年于西北工业大学获博士学位(硕博连读)

u  工作经历

§  2009-2013加拿大西安大略大学博士后 

§  2014-2018加拿大康考迪亚大学博士后 

§  2018年至今威尼斯人棋牌特别研究员/博导 

u  研究领域

抗干扰容错控制,无人机安全控制,飞行器导航与控制

u  荣誉及奖励

§  四次获得国际学术会议“最佳论文”、“最佳论文提名”等荣誉
